Tektronix Inc.'s methods of implementation (MOI) document for the new Ultra-Wideband (UWB) WiMedia PHY Test Specification Version 1.2 reflects the additional receiver testing required in the spec.
In addition to the cookbook, the company also released a new version of UWB Analysis software for DSA/DPO70000 series oscilloscopes to accommodate additional measurements specified for UWB WiMedia 1.2.
For UWB WiMedia radios using MB-OFDM technology for Certified Wireless USB, next generation Bluetooth, WiNet and Wireless FireWire (IEEE1394) applications, the UWB Analysis software reads the digital information from the RF waveform to determine the demodulation method on a packet-by-packet basis.
The software automatically determines which demodulation method is used, data rates, time frequency coding, the pass/fail test limits, and constellation type that is then displayed. Detection and analysis is done on each packet from the RF content, greatly simplifying setup and speeding analysis and compliance tests.
UWB Analysis is augmented by a real-time oscilloscope and provides the specific modulation and spectral analysis for WiMedia Version 1.2. This is especially useful for engineers designing, testing and integrating UWB radios into Certified Wireless USB, next generation Bluetooth, and other industry consumer and computer applications.
